Britains Millionaire Criminals

Why are some convicted criminals still enjoying luxury lifestyles funded by their ill-gotten gains?

Successive governments have pledged to ensure crime doesn't pay and that the public purse will get these rich criminals' money.

However, a Channel 4 Dispatches investigation has discovered that dozens of fraudsters, drug dealers and money launderers are still enjoying the high life despite being convicted of serious crimes.

Luxury properties, fast cars and overseas bank accounts are supposed to be in reach of the long arm of the law.

Despite this, Dispatches reveals the institutional failings and legal loopholes that result in some of the country's most serious offenders being able to retain their criminal wealth, and discovers that the state has failed to recover even a fifth of the cash that Britain's wealthiest criminals have been ordered to pay back.

Reporter Antony Barnett speaks to police, lawyers and a convicted money launderer who explains how easy it is to avoid having criminal assets confiscated by the authorities.

He discovers a combination of legal obstacles and incompetence mean smart criminals are evading the justice system.

Dispatches goes on the hunt for the criminals who have found that crime does pay.
